furtive

/ˈfɜːrtɪv/ adjective · British & US
Valid in UKValid in US
Share WhatsApp

What does furtive mean?

adjective

Secretive or stealthy in movement or action; sneaking or lurking about. Furtive glances were exchanged between the two lovers.

Example

"The thief cast a furtive glance over his shoulder before making a run for it."
